China Launches Online Book Expo
China's first international online book expo started in Beijing Friday, attracting hundreds of foreign and domestic publishers.

The China International Online Book Expo was sponsored by the China International Publishing Group and jointly organized by www.china.org.cn, the China International Book Trading Corporation andwww.guojishudian.com.
The expo, scheduled to run till Oct. 9, has attracted 449 foreign publishers including such big names as McGraw-Hill and 374domestic publishers including the People's Publishing House and Commercial Publishing House.
At the website expo.cnokay.com, Internet surfers can access 1.2million pieces of information on Chinese books and one million on foreign books. Over 120,000 books are listed online and a series of book exhibitions, sales and copyright trading activities will be held online during the expo period.
Liu Binjie, deputy director of the General Administration of Press and Publications, said at Friday's opening ceremony that theonline expo provides an excellent platform for bridging gaps between domestic and foreign publishers.
